How to use the Feynman Learning Method?
You may ask: "How do I do it specifically?" Don't worry, the following four steps will help you master this magical skill step by step!
Step 1: Identify your target area
No matter what you study, you must first clarify the area you want to master.
Break this goal down into several small goals, such as studying one chapter at a time.
Small goals make it easier for you to grasp the overall situation, and it won’t make you feel stressed.
Step 2: Teaching instead of learning
This step is the essence of the Feynman learning method! Imagine yourself as a professor and summarize what you have learned into amind Mapping.
Mind maps can help you organize information better and connect various knowledge points.
Then, start teaching! There is no need for actual audiences, you can treat the air as students.
Try to explain each concept in your own words.
If you get stuck, it means you are not familiar enough with this point and need to go back and learn it again.
Step 3: Review
After you finish teaching a round, don't rush to celebrate. You need to look back and see where you didn't teach smoothly.
Take out your red pen and circle the knowledge points that need further reinforcement.
Feynman Learning Method: Strengthening Investigation and Filling in the Gaps, only by finding and solving your knowledge blind spots can you actually master the content.
Step 4: Simplify and internalize
The last step is to simplify complex knowledge. Whether you really master a knowledge point depends on whether you can explain it in the simplest language.
Let knowledgeIntegrate into your mindset, making it a "tool" that you can call upon at any time.

Feynman learning method is not limited to subject learning
You may think that the Feynman method is only suitable for liberal arts or theoretical subjects, but this is not the case. It is also applicable to science, skill learning, and evenLifeVarious practical applications in .
For example, if you are learning programming, don't just read books or watch video tutorials.
Try writing code yourself and teach others how to write it.
This process not only deepens your understanding, but also helps you discover your own logical errors or misunderstandings in certain areas.

How to effectively implement the Feynman method?
Of course, the Feynman method is not a magic potion that will turn you into a top student overnight.
It requires you to practice and think more to gradually improve.
Common Misconceptions
Some people mistakenly believe that as long as they teach others, they will automatically become experts.
But the fact is, if you teach it incorrectly or fail to understand it thoroughly, it will only reinforce the wrong impression.
therefore,After each output, be sure to reflect and review, look for the part you don’t understand.
